08:30-09:05 | Keynote Speech (VII) Session Chair: Keynote Speaker: Prof. Seungkwan (SK) Hong Title: Advancing Desalination Technologies: From Seawater Desalination To Ultrapure-water Production Bio: Dr. Seungkwan (SK) Hong is a professor in the School of Civil, Environmental and Architectural Engineering at Korea University (KU). He is also a dean of Graduate School of Energy and Environment, which was established and supported by KU and KIST (Korean Institute of Science and Technology). He obtained Ph.D. degree in Civil engineering from University of California, Los Angeles (UCLA) in 1996. Before joining Korea University in 2003, he served as an assistant professor in the department of Civil and Environmental Engineering at University of Central Florida (UCF), USA (1997~2003). His primary research involves the development of membrane technologies for drinking water treatment, seawater desalination, water reuse, and industrial processes such as ultrapure water production and shale oil/gas produced water treatment as well as electrochemical water treatment technologies. He has (co)authored more than 190 academic papers published in internationally renowned journals (h-index: 61 (Google) and 54 (Scopus) with more than 15,900 and 12,000 citations). With the broad experiences in the related field, he successfully perfectly served as a director of Korean Optimized Reverse osmosis membrane-based desalination integrated with Advanced Energy saving (KORAE) research project (research fund: 36.8 million US dollar, 2016-2022). In addition to his research work, he has actively participated in various academic societies. Professor Hong is a representative of IWA Korean National Committee, a vice president of KSWE (Korean Society of Environmental Engineers) and KMS (Korean Membrane Society). He also served as an Editor of Journal of Membrane Science, Associate Editors of Desalination and Water Treatment, and a member of Editorial Board of Desalination. |

09:05-09:40 | Keynote Speech (VIII) Session Chair: Keynote Speaker: Prof. William Mitch Title: From the Linear to the Circular Urban Water Cycle: From Disposal to Resource Recovery Bio: William Mitch is a Professor in the Department of Civil and Environmental Engineering at Stanford University. He has studied disinfection byproduct formation mechanisms over the past 20 years, with a particular focus on nitrosamines. His research focuses on conventional drinking water and potable reuse, including MF/RO/AOP systems, O3/BAC-based systems, advanced oxidation processes and treatment of RO concentrate. He has evaluated techniques to minimize the formation of disinfection byproducts. He obtained a BA in Archaeology from Harvard University and MS and PhD degrees in Civil and Environmental Engineering from the University of California at Berkeley. He received the 2004 Outstanding Doctoral Dissertation Award from the Association of Environmental Engineering and Science Professors and Parsons Engineering, and a NSF Career Award in 2007. He served as the Chair of the 2017 Disinfection Byproducts Gordon Conference. He has received research funding from the National Science Foundation, the Water Research Foundation, and the United State Department of Agriculture. He has served on the EPA’s Scientific Advisory Panel’s Drinking Water Committee and on National Water Research Institute expert panels evaluating potable reuse projects for the Las Virgenes-Triunfo drinking water plant and the cities of Los Angeles and San Diego. He holds a PE license in California. |

15:00-16:30 | Keynote Speech (IX) Session Chairs: Keynote Speaker: Prof. Shang-Lien Lo Title: Climate Resilient Urban Nexus: Operationalizing the Food-Water-Energy Nexus and Taiwan Urban Living Lab Bio: Dr. Shang-Lien Lo is a Distinguished Professor of the Graduate Institute of Environmental Engineering at National Taiwan University (NTU). He graduated from NTU in 1975 with a B.S. in Civil Engineering and entered the graduate program at NTU to receive his M.S. and Ph.D. in Environmental Engineering (1983). Upon graduation, he became an associate professor at NTU. He then conducted postdoctoral research at Stanford University from 1985-1987 and received tenure at NTU in 1989. He was the Director of Graduate Institute of Environmental Engineering at NTU during 1996 – 2002. He has contributed greatly to the establishing curricular programs and course syllabi of fields of environmental planning and management during this period. Professor Lo has made long term and significant contributions in water and environmental research and engineering, especially in water resources and water quality treatment, decomposition of chlorinated and perfluorinated compounds, treatment of wastewater and heavy metal-containing sludge, microwave pyrolysis of biomass waste, and environment and ecosystem management. Prof Lo’s research achievement has been receiving many academic honors, including Outstanding Research Award and Distinguished Research Medal from NSC; Outstanding Engineering Professor Medal; Ho Chin Tui Outstanding Env. Technology Prize; ICCE Fellow; CICHE Fellow; Y.Z. Hsu Scientific Chair Professor; Environmental Protection Medal, Taiwan EPA; IWA Distinguished Fellow; TECO Technology Award; BCEEM; D.WRE; ASCE Fellow; IETI Distinguished Fellow and Academician of the European Academy of Sciences and Arts. |
